Factors Surrounding the Severity of Sexual Assaults among Native Americans

Abstract

This session looks to elaborate on the impact of various factors that may influence the severity of sexual assaults within the Native American population. Trained student researchers working with the Center for Applied Criminal Case Analysis analyzed federal sexual assault cases from a Native American sample. Factors discussed in this session will include whether or not the offender was using alcohol during the commission of a sexual assault, the offender's drug use history, use of force during the commission of a sexual assault, and whether the offender appeared to be situational or preferential.
